Izzy's candles for CLEFT

Izzy's candles for CLEFT

Izzy is in year 9 at Warminster School and was invited to take part in a project called the FPQ. The objective of the project is to write an essay or create a product on any subject and present it at the end of the school year. Izzy's plan to make and sell candles for CLEFT has been a huge success and over £600 was raised. Read more

    Our mission

    CLEFT was established in 2007 with one aim, to help improve the lives of children born with cleft lip and palate, either by funding research into the likely causes of the condition or by helping support teams in lower and middle income countries.

    About us

    CLEFT was established in 2007 by cleft surgeon Brian Sommerlad - based at Great Ormond Street Hospital for Children, together with a former patient and a patient's grandmother.
